Salt Composition

Levosalbutamol (1mg/5ml) + Ambroxol (30mg/5ml) + Guaifenesin (50mg/5ml)

How Gricof-LS Syrup works:

Syrup Gricof-LS combines Levosalbutamol, Ambroxol, and Guaifenesin to alleviate coughs accompanied by phlegm. Levosalbutamol, a bronchodilator, opens the airways by relaxing airway muscles. Ambroxol, a mucolytic agent, liquefies mucus, facilitating expectoration. Guaifenesin, an expectorant, reduces mucus viscosity, aiding its clearance from the respiratory tract.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concurrent use of Gricof-LS Syrup and alcohol may result in increased s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Gricof-LS Syrup during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ential benefits against any poss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Nursing mothers can likely use Gricof-LS Syrup without significant concern. Available data from human studies indicate minimal ris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by the side effects of Gricof-LS Syrup.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ney disease should use Gricof-LS Syrup cautiously, potentially requiring a modified dosage. Physician consultation is advised due to limited data regarding its use in this population.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Gricof-LS Syrup c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is advised, as data regarding its use in such patients is limited.

What if you forget to take Gricof-LS Syrup :

Should you forget a dose of Gricof-LS Syrup,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.
